We invite you to Dr. Funk where you, too, can escape.Dr. Funk's offers a relaxed vibe that transports you into a 19th Samoa tiki venue with signature cocktails that include our Mai Tai and the Dr. Funk. Our Signature dishes include our Dr. Funk Burger and Hawaiian Ribs.We are located near O'Flaherty's Irish Pub and the Old Spaghetti Factory in the heart of downtown San Jose.Trader Vic and Donn Beach invented the tiki motif at their California restaurants of the 1930s that would entice generations for nearly a century. Our eclectic décor, too, draws influence from both Trader Vic and Donn Beach. Both Trader Vic and Donn Beach sought not to create a fantasy world that was hinged on any single location; but rather one that encompassed the concept of escapism by incorporating and embracing elements from the Caribbean, to the South Pacific, China, Singapore and beyond!In doing so, they created a backdrop that was thrilling, fascinating and alluring—one we wish to pay homage to.

Zuni Café opened in San Francisco, California on February 15, 1979. Our daily changing menus are inspired by seasonal organic ingredients and incorporate traditional French and Italian cuisine. As Zuni continues to evolve, in its own distinctive and delicious way, it strives to remain the way it’s always been: at the same time rustic and cosmopolitan, audacious and familiar, intimate and convivial.RESERVATIONS ARE TAKEN UP TO 4 WEEKS IN ADVANCE.TABLES ARE RESERVED FOR A 2 HOUR TIME LIMIT.
